aboutsummaryrefslogtreecommitdiffstats
path: root/frontends
diff options
context:
space:
mode:
authorEddie Hung <eddie@fpgeh.com>2020-01-24 10:12:52 -0800
committerEddie Hung <eddie@fpgeh.com>2020-01-24 10:12:52 -0800
commitcccc0ae112ffbe9bdf74c6231eee959ecad55f69 (patch)
treed1013d44a639a54c750458cbe4f34df9e3364eb5 /frontends
parentda6abc014987ef562a577dc374bcb03aad9256cd (diff)
downloadyosys-cccc0ae112ffbe9bdf74c6231eee959ecad55f69.tar.gz
yosys-cccc0ae112ffbe9bdf74c6231eee959ecad55f69.tar.bz2
yosys-cccc0ae112ffbe9bdf74c6231eee959ecad55f69.zip
verific: unflatten struct ports
Diffstat (limited to 'frontends')
-rw-r--r--frontends/verific/verific.cc3
1 files changed, 3 insertions, 0 deletions
diff --git a/frontends/verific/verific.cc b/frontends/verific/verific.cc
index 9274cf5ca..a8e8a3dc3 100644
--- a/frontends/verific/verific.cc
+++ b/frontends/verific/verific.cc
@@ -2470,6 +2470,9 @@ struct VerificPass : public Pass {
worker.run(nl);
}
+ for (auto nl : nl_todo)
+ nl->ChangePortBusStructures(1 /* hierarchical */);
+
if (!dumpfile.empty()) {
VeriWrite veri_writer;
veri_writer.WriteFile(dumpfile.c_str(), Netlist::PresentDesign());